Are there any scholarships or financial aid options available for the OfQual Award in Education and Training part time?

Many individuals who are interested in pursuing the OfQual Award in Education and Training part time may be wondering if there are any scholarships or financial aid options available to help offset the cost of the program. Fortunately, there are several options that students can explore to help make their educational goals more attainable.

One popular option for financial aid is the Advanced Learner Loan. This loan is specifically designed to help individuals cover the cost of further education and training courses, including the OfQual Award in Education and Training. The loan is not based on income or credit history, making it accessible to a wide range of students. Additionally, the loan only needs to be repaid once the student is earning over a certain threshold, making it a manageable option for many individuals.

Another option to consider is scholarships. While scholarships specifically for the OfQual Award in Education and Training may be limited, there are often general education scholarships that students can apply for to help cover the cost of their program. It is worth researching scholarship opportunities through educational institutions, foundations, and other organizations to see if there are any options available that align with your educational goals.

Additionally, some employers may offer tuition reimbursement programs for employees who are pursuing further education. If you are currently employed, it may be worth speaking with your employer to see if they offer any financial assistance for educational programs such as the OfQual Award in Education and Training.

Lastly, students may also want to explore payment plans offered by educational institutions that provide the OfQual Award in Education and Training. Many schools offer flexible payment options that allow students to spread out the cost of their program over time, making it more manageable for individuals who may not have the funds to pay for the program upfront.
